Librarians Salary in the Industry of General Medical and Surgical Hospitals - Privately owned

The salary statistics and trend of librarians in the industry of general medical and surgical hospitals - privately owned are shown in the following tables and chart. In Table 3 we compare librarians salaries in different industries within the health care and social assistance sector.

Table 1. Average Annual Salary

Percentile BracketAverage Annual Salary
10th Percentile Wage
$32,570
25th Percentile Wage
$44,090
50th Percentile Wage
$57,570
75th Percentile Wage
$71,400
90th Percentile Wage
$83,190

Table 1 shows the average annual salaries for librarians in the industry of general medical and surgical hospitals - privately owned. The salaries are shown in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) librarians is $83,190. The median annual salary (50th percentile) is $57,570.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ent librarians is $32,570.

Salary Trend (2012 to 2017)

The table and chart below show the trend of the median salary of librarians in the industry of General Medical and Surgical Hospitals - Privately owned from 2012 to 2017.

YearMedian SalaryYearly Growth5-Year Growth
2017
$57,570
0.33% 7.43%
2016
$57,380
-1.22% -
2015
$58,080
1.77% -
2014
$57,050
1.63% -
2013
$56,120
5.04% -
2012
$53,290
- -
